      <Abstract>As in this paper we have proposed a cloud data storage redefines the security issues and targeted on customer&amp;rsquo;s outsourced data (data that is not stored/retrieved from the costumers own servers). In this project we came to know, from a customer&amp;rsquo;s point of view, relying upon a solo Service Provider (SP) for his outsourced data is not very promising. In this we have proposed security as well as availability in this there are data divided into parts store on different providers the data which is divided is also store on backup servers so if the data could not get retrieve from main server can be retrieved from the backup server so it ensures availability and as data is divided into parts it is secured and whole data could not be changed or retrieved by someone else.</Abstract>
